Title: Innovations of Woo Suk Jung
Introduction
Woo Suk Jung is a prominent inventor based in Hwaseong-si, South Korea. He has made significant contributions to the field of air mobility with a total of 12 patents to his name. His work focuses on enhancing the efficiency and functionality of air vehicles.
Latest Patents
Among his latest innovations is the "Auxiliary Propulsion Apparatus for Air Vehicle." This invention includes an engine mounted in the fuselage, a generator driven by the engine, and a compressor that can be powered by either the engine or the generator. It also features a battery for storing electricity, an electricity distributor, and a nozzle device for jetting high-pressure gas. Another notable patent is the "Hybrid Air Mobility Vehicle," which allows for long-distance flights through efficient engine and battery operation. This vehicle reduces noise and discomfort during flights by utilizing a controller that manages the engine, clutch, and drive motor based on various flight factors.
Career Highlights
Woo Suk Jung has worked with notable companies such as Hyundai Motor Company and Kia Corporation. His experience in these organizations has contributed to his expertise in developing innovative air mobility solutions.
Collaborations
He has collaborated with talented individuals in the field, including Hee Kwang Lee and Hyun Seok Hong. Their combined efforts have led to advancements in air vehicle technology.
